/*common*/
body { color: #333; }
.m_block { display: block }
.m_clearfix:after { content: "."; display: block; clear: both; height: 0; overflow: hidden }
.m_clearfix { zoom: 1 }
.fl-l { float: left; }
.fl-r { float: right; }
.wp { width: 3.75rem; margin: 0 auto; overflow: hidden; }
.wp * { box-sizing: border-box; }
.w350 { width: 3.5rem; margin: 0 auto; }
.title { height: .8rem; color: #000; line-height: .8rem; overflow: hidden; }
.title h2 { display: inline-block; float: left; font-size: .12rem; }
.title h2 strong { font-size: .2rem; }
.title a { float: right; font-size: .14rem; font-weight: bold; color: #000; }
.kf { width: 2.67rem; height: .44rem; margin: .3rem auto .35rem; border-radius: .22rem; background: linear-gradient(#fd6a0a, #d72d17); }
.kf a { display: block; width: 100%; height: .22rem; font-size: .12rem; font-weight: bold; text-align: center; overflow: hidden; }
.kf .to-form { color: #ffe400; line-height: .26rem; }
.kf .tq { color: #fff; }
/*banner*/
.banner { width: 3.75rem; height: 2rem; background: url(http://cdn.img.lx.zmnedu.com/static/psjh/images/banner.jpg); background-size: 3.75rem; overflow: hidden; }
/*part1*/
.part1 { width: 100%; height: .6rem; background-color: #f7c914; }
.part1 p { padding-top: .1rem; font-size: .12rem; font-weight: bold; color: #000; line-height: .2rem; text-align: center; }
/*part2*/
.part2 .cont { height: 2.86rem; overflow: hidden; }
.part2 .fl-l { width: .77rem; height: 2.87rem; }
.part2 .fl-l img { width: 100%; }
.part2 .fl-r { width: 2.69rem; }
.part2 .fl-r dl { width: 100%; height: .46rem; margin-bottom: .02rem; }
.part2 .fl-r dl dt { float: left; width: .24rem; height: .46rem; background-color: #fdcd1a; font-size: .13rem; font-weight: bold; line-height: .46rem; text-align: center; }
.part2 .fl-r dl dd { float: right; width: 2.43rem; height: .46rem; padding: .09rem .15rem; background-color: #196ed8; font-size: .11rem; color: #fff; line-height: .14rem; }
.part2 .fl-r dl dd.pt16 { padding-top: .16rem; }
/*part3*/
.part3 { background-color: #196ed8; overflow: hidden; }
.part3 .title { color: #fff; }
.part3 .title a { color: #fff; }
.part3 .cont { height: 2.84rem; }
.part3 dl { position: relative; float: left; width: 1.37rem; height: 1.34rem; margin: 0 .19rem .16rem; }
.part3 dl dt { position: relative; width: .49rem; height: .49rem; margin: 0 auto; z-index: 2; }
.part3 dl dt img { width: 100%; }
.part3 dl dd { position: absolute; top: .21rem; width: 100%; height: 1.13rem; background-color: #fff; font-size: .11rem; color: #0c224b; line-height: .17rem; text-align: center; z-index: 1; }
.part3 dl dd strong { display: block; margin: .38rem 0 .08rem; font-size: .12rem; }
/*part4*/
.part4 .cont { height: 1.69rem; background: url(http://cdn.img.lx.zmnedu.com/static/psjh/images/p4-bg.jpg); background-size: 100%; overflow: hidden; }
.part4 .cont ul li { float: left; width: .94rem; height: .3rem; margin: 0 .34rem .39rem 0; font-size: .13rem; font-weight: bold; line-height: .3rem; text-align: center; }
.part4 .cont ul li:nth-child(3n) { margin-right: 0; }
/*part5*/
.part5 { background: #f3f3f3; overflow: hidden; }
.part5 ul { height: 1.15rem; }
.part5 ul li { float: left; width: 1.15rem; height: 1.15rem; padding: .25rem 0 0 .09rem; background: url(http://cdn.img.lx.zmnedu.com/static/psjh/images/p5-img-02.jpg); background-size: 100%; font-size: .12rem; font-weight: bold; color: #fff; }
.part5 ul li span { display: block; margin-top: .04rem; }
.part5 ul li:first-child { margin-right: .02rem; background: url(http://cdn.img.lx.zmnedu.com/static/psjh/images/p5-img-01.jpg); background-size: 100%; }
.part5 ul li:last-child { float: right; background: url(http://cdn.img.lx.zmnedu.com/static/psjh/images/p5-img-03.jpg); background-size: 100%; }
/*part6*/
.part6 table { width: 100%; font-size: .1rem; }
.part6 table tr th { height: .19rem; border: #fff 1px solid; background-color: #196ed8; color: #fff; }
.part6 table tr td { height: .18rem; border: #fff 1px solid; text-align: center; }
.part6 table tr:nth-child(odd) td { background-color: #e8f0fb; }
/*part7*/
.part7 { background-color: #f3f3f3; overflow: hidden; }
.part7 table { width: 100%; font-size: .1rem; }
.part7 table tr th { height: .21rem; border: #fff 1px solid; background-color: #196ed8; color: #fff; }
.part7 table tr td { padding: .09rem 0; border: #fff 1px solid; text-align: center; }
.part7 table tr:nth-child(odd) td { background-color: #e8f0fb; }
/*part8*/
.part8 { background-color: #196ed8; overflow: hidden; }
.part8 .title { color: #fff; }
.part8 .title a { color: #fff; }
.part8 #form_common { width: 100%; height: 3.08rem; padding-top: .35rem; background-color: #fff; box-shadow: 0 0 .05rem 0 #0b45b7; }
.part8 #form_common dd label { display: none; }
.part8 #form_common dd input { display: block; width: 3rem; height: .45rem; margin: 0 auto .17rem; padding-left: .23rem; border: #e4e4e4 1px solid; font-size: .12rem; }
.part8 #form_common dt a { display: block; width: 2.5rem; height: .45rem; margin: 0 auto; border: #f85f2f 1px solid; border-radius: .22rem; background: linear-gradient(#fd6a0a, #d72d17); font-size: .15rem; font-weight: bold; color: #fff; line-height: .44rem; text-align: center; }
.part8 .bottom { margin-top: .18rem; background: url(http://cdn.img.lx.zmnedu.com/static/psjh/images/p8-img.jpg) no-repeat right top; background-size: .98rem; }
.part8 .bottom ul { padding: 0 0 .25rem .14rem; }
.part8 .bottom ul li { font-size: .11rem; color: #fff; line-height: .21rem; }
.part8 .bottom ul li:first-child { margin-bottom: .04rem; font-size: .12rem; font-weight: bold; color: #ffcb00; }
.part8 .bottom a { display: block; width: 288px; height: 50px; border: #f85f2f 1px solid; border-radius: 25px; background-color: #fff; font-size: 18px; font-weight: bold; color: #f85f2f; line-height: 50px; text-align: center; }
.part8 .bottom a:hover { background: linear-gradient(#fd6a0a, #d72d17); color: #fff; }
/*part9*/
.part9 .title { height: .7rem; }
.part9 .cont { height: 2.25rem; background: url(http://cdn.img.lx.zmnedu.com/static/psjh/images/p9-img.jpg) no-repeat right .12rem; background-size: 1.02rem; }
.part9 .cont p { width: 2.37rem; font-size: .1rem; line-height: .18rem; }
.part9 .cont p strong { font-size: .09rem; line-height: .26rem; }








